How they compare

Latvia currently reports 6,360 against 5,357 in Cyprus, a difference of 1,003.

That makes Latvia's figure about 1.2 times Cyprus's.

Across all 35 years both countries report, Latvia has been ahead every year.

Cyprus ranks 26th and Latvia ranks 25th of 32 countries.

Latvia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Cyprus Latvia Difference Ahead
1990s 1,522 7,600 6,078 Latvia
2000s 1,970 6,668 4,698 Latvia
2010s 3,006 6,367 3,361 Latvia
2020s 4,759 6,347 1,588 Latvia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
